Direct sales manager Jobs in Cape town
Show all jobs |
Show new jobs
jobs 1 - 1 of 1
-
Sales Engineer (Cape Town)
- Cape town | Jan 20, 2021 Network Recruitment
- Network Recruitment - Cape Town, Western Cape - Job Description: Calling on Consulting engineers, project houses, municipalities as directed by the Branch Manager